About this book
Set in a desolate frontier settlement where every living creature broadcasts its thoughts as audible “Noise,” this novel follows thirteen-year-old Todd Hewitt as he navigates a world shaped by inherited lies. The constant stream of unfiltered consciousness forces Todd to confront the gap between public narrative and private truth, challenging the isolated community’s foundational myths. Through a tightly controlled first-person perspective, the narrative examines how isolation and manufactured history can distort perception, while exploring the burdens of inherited masculinity and the courage required to question established authority. The novel’s distinctive auditory conceit transforms internal monologue into a tangible environmental force, allowing readers to experience the protagonist’s growing awareness of propaganda and self-deception. Recognized for its inventive narrative structure and unflinching look at how communities construct reality, the work establishes a foundation for examining truth, identity, and the responsibility of bearing witness in a fractured world.
